Well, the skunks are back and this time one of them is an albino, or at least partial albino. I also think it is blind from the way it stayed on the back right side of the adult it was with. Every turn left or right it stayed right there. My little cybershot camera is on its last leg apparently plus I had the zoom out and that's the reason the pic is so grainy.

321358.jpg


The tail of the albino was completely bright white and its body had some of the usual markings as in stripes but there was no black. The lead skunk looked normal. The two of them actually looked like one animal they were walking so close together.
